Key Metrics in Sports Analytics for Betting
At the core of effective sports analytics for betting are key performance indicators (KPIs) that offer a quantifiable measure of a team’s or player’s effectiveness. For football, metrics like expected goals (xG), possession statistics, and defensive duels won are vital. In basketball, advanced stats such as player efficiency rating (PER), true shooting percentage, and assist-to-turnover ratios provide invaluable insights. Analyzing these metrics allows bettors to discern underlying strengths and weaknesses that might not be immediately apparent from standard win-loss records.
Beyond individual player statistics, team-level analytics are equally important. This includes analyzing offensive and defensive efficiency ratings, pace of play, and effectiveness in specific game situations like power plays or penalty shootouts. Understanding how teams perform under pressure, their ability to adapt to different opponents, and their historical performance against specific styles of play are all critical components that data analytics can illuminate. This holistic view is essential for making well-rounded tactical betting choices.
Predictive Modeling and Probability Assessment
Sports analytics heavily relies on predictive modeling to forecast the likelihood of various outcomes. These models can range from simple statistical regressions to complex machine learning algorithms. By feeding historical data and real-time information into these models, bettors can gain a probabilistic edge. Understanding the projected win probabilities, score differentials, or even the likelihood of specific events occurring within a game can significantly inform betting decisions.
The accuracy of predictive models is continuously refined through ongoing data collection and algorithm adjustments. This iterative process allows for a dynamic assessment of probabilities, adapting to new trends and performance shifts. For a bettor, this means having access to constantly updated insights, enabling them to react to changes and identify value bets where the market’s perception of probability may differ from the model’s projection. This is where tactical betting choices truly come to life.
Leveraging Sports Analytics for Tactical Betting Choices
The ultimate goal of sports analytics in betting is to translate data-driven insights into actionable strategies. This involves identifying discrepancies between perceived odds and actual probabilities. For instance, if analytics suggest a team is undervalued based on its underlying performance metrics, a bettor might see this as an opportunity. Similarly, understanding a team’s fatigue levels based on their schedule, or their historical performance against a specific opponent’s tactics, can lead to more informed wagers.
Furthermore, sports analytics can help in identifying trends and patterns that might be overlooked. This could involve analyzing how teams perform after a loss, the impact of specific player injuries, or the effect of home-field advantage under different conditions. By systematically dissecting these elements, bettors can refine their approach, moving towards a more analytical and less emotional betting process. This systematic application of data is key to making consistently tactical betting choices.
